Earn your ESL certificate in two summers!
Temple's ESL certificate program prepares teachers to work effectively in Pennsylvania public K-12 schools with children learning English as a second language. The program creates a foundation in language theory to guide practice and helps teachers develop familiarity with multiple literacies.

The Temple University 2011 Autism Summer Institute will feature presentations about Autism Spectrum Disorder (ASD), Applied Behavior Analysis, and Positive Behavior Support from nationally known experts in the field. To learn more about what will be covered, please review the presentation topics.

Who should attend? Teachers, school psychologists, behavior analysts, behavior specialists, administrators, parents, and anyone who supports people with Autism Spectrum Disorder.
